AMD
AMD is an American multinational semiconductor company based in Santa Clara, California, that develops central processing units (CPUs), graphics processing units (GPUs), and system-on-chips (SoCs). The company serves business and consumer markets, including personal computers, data centers, gaming, and embedded systems. Following its 2022 acquisition of Xilinx, AMD also offers field-programmable gate array (FPGA) products. Founded in 1969, the company outsourced its manufacturing after spinning off GlobalFoundries in 2009. AMD is a primary competitor to Intel in the microprocessor market. Its current focus, as stated by leadership, remains on enterprise markets amid broader PC market uncertainty.
Microsoft
Microsoft Corporation is an American multinational technology conglomerate. The company develops, manufactures, licenses, supports, and sells computer software, consumer electronics, personal computers, and related services. Its foundational products include the Windows line of operating systems, the Microsoft Office suite, and the Internet Explorer and Edge web browsers. Microsoft rose to dominate the personal computer operating system market with MS-DOS and later Windows. The company has since expanded into areas including cloud computing with Azure, artificial intelligence, and video gaming with the Xbox console line. Under CEO Satya Nadella, Microsoft has shifted its focus toward cloud services and enterprise software, and it is currently ranked among the top companies in the artificial intelligence industry.
